Is Mold Dangerous?

Mold is a type of fungus that develops in dark and damp environments, and is commonly found in homes with excess moisture. It can appear in a variety of colors, from black and green to white and orange, and flourishes in spaces with high humidity, water infiltration, and poor airflow. It can be present on cellulose-based items, including walls, ceilings, floors, carpets, and even furniture. A mold inspector will usually inspect for evidence of leaks and water in a house to locate the likeliest catalyst for any mold growth.

While many types of mold are benign, others have been known to cause health concerns, especially for people who are at risk. People with allergies, asthma, or weakened immune systems have been known to experience symptoms such as a stuffy nose, coughing, wheezing, and rash. Animals can also be negatively impacted by the fungus, with common symptoms of respiratory distress, vomiting, and digestive issues. While mold may not typically present a considerable risk to the health of most people, it’s particularly bad for many common building materials found inside of homes. Mold spores occupy and consume plant-based materials and ruin them over time. Some cellulose or plant-based materials found inside of houses include:

  • Drywall
  • Wood
  • Carpet
  • Insulation
  • Ceiling tiles
  • Wallpaper
  • Fabrics
  • Upholstery
  • Some Painted surfaces
  • Paper
  • Cardboard
  • And More

How Is an Expert Mold Inspection Conducted?

Our mold inspectors use the latest technology and have extensive knowledge of home construction to evaluate the air and surfaces for mold spores. Our mold testing will deliver the best insights into the current state of your home regarding mold infestation and the next steps you can take to address the problem. Our process includes:

  • Initial Assessment: The mold inspector from Pillar To Post™ acquires information about the property, any noted mold issues, and your concerns during the initial consultation to design a plan for mold testing.
  • Visual Inspection: The next step of our mold inspection service includes a meticulous visual assessment of the property, both inside and out, seeking for signs of mold growth, water leaks, and other moisture-related concerns. We examine areas susceptible to mold infestation, such as basements, crawl spaces, bathrooms, attics, and spaces with plumbing or HVAC appliances.
  • Moisture detection: Specialized equipment like moisture meters, thermal cameras, or hygrometers may be employed to identify hidden moisture within building materials, such as walls, floors, and ceilings, that could facilitate mold growth.
  • Air Sampling: Mold testing may call for air samples to be extracted from different areas of the home using specific equipment. The air samples will be sent to a lab for evaluation to confirm the type and concentration of mold spores found in the air.
  • Surface Sampling: The inspector may also obtain surface samples from areas of the house where the fungus is suspected. These samples will be sent to a lab for evaluation to confirm the type of mold found.
  • Documentation and Reporting: A thorough report will be furnished to clients after the mold inspection is done, including any areas of the home where mold was identified, the variety of mold present, and advice for mitigation.
  • Recommendations and Remediation Plan: Depending on the inspection results, the inspector gives advice to address the mold problem and halt further growth.
  • Follow-up and Clearance Testing: A subsequent assessment may be executed to ensure that the cleanup efforts were successful and that the mold issue has been adequately addressed.
  • Education and Prevention: The inspector enlightens the client about mold precaution measures, including appropriate ventilation, humidity management, and maintenance practices.
